The Cooking Class
Led by a local cook who shares stories and tips along the way, the class is highly interactive. The focus is on traditional Sri Lankan recipes, which typically include rice, vegetable curries, sambols, and other local dishes. The menu isn’t fixed; it varies with seasonal ingredients, giving you a glimpse into the region’s agricultural bounty. Vegetarian options are available, and the hosts are happy to accommodate dietary needs if you notify them in advance.
Reviewers have appreciated the hands-on approach, mentioning how the instructor patiently explained each step and demonstrated traditional techniques. One noted, “I loved learning how to balance spices and serve the dishes as they do at home.” The emphasis on local, fresh ingredients and aromatic spices really helps you understand what makes Sri Lankan cuisine so vibrant and flavorful.

Practical Details and Considerations
.jpg)
Duration and Timing
The experience lasts about 3 hours, making it an ideal evening activity after a safari or day of sightseeing. The class begins in the late afternoon, aligning with golden hour—hence the name—offering a lovely ambiance for cooking and chatting.
Group Size and Guides
Limited to 10 participants, the small group size ensures personalized attention and an intimate atmosphere. The instructor speaks English, making explanations clear and accessible for international travelers.
Cost and Value
While the exact price isn’t specified here, the experience includes the instruction, ingredients, and a full meal—so you’re getting an entire culinary lesson plus a shared dinner at a reasonable value. It’s a chance to learn authentic recipes directly from locals while enjoying an authentic Sri Lankan meal, which is often more meaningful and memorable than just dining out.
Accessibility and Booking
Reservations can be made with free cancellation up to 24 hours in advance, offering flexibility for your travel plans. You can reserve now and pay later, which is handy if your itinerary might shift.
Additional Info
The class is conducted in English, suitable for international travelers. Vegetarian options are available, and dietary needs can be accommodated with advance notice.

FAQ
.jpg)
Do I need cooking experience to join this class?
No, the class is suitable for all skill levels, from complete beginners to experienced cooks. The instructor demonstrates each step and explains techniques clearly.
What dishes will I learn to prepare?
You’ll typically learn to make rice, vegetable curries, sambols, and other local specialties. The menu varies depending on seasonal ingredients.
Can I request vegetarian or special dietary options?
Yes, vegetarian options are available, and other dietary requirements can be accommodated if you inform the host in advance.
How long does the experience last?
It lasts approximately 3 hours, beginning in the late afternoon, perfect for a relaxing evening activity.
Is transportation provided?
The tour takes place at Silent Bungalow in Udawalawe; check with the provider if transportation is included or if you need to arrange your own.
What is included in the price?
The price covers the cooking class, ingredients, and the home-cooked meal you prepare. Beverages like tea and cake are also included on arrival.
Is this experience suitable for children?
Yes, it’s suitable for families and children who enjoy cooking and cultural activities, provided they are supervised and interested in the experience.
How do I book this experience?
Reservations can be made through the provider’s platform, with flexible options for cancellation up to 24 hours in advance.
